package jaitools.numeric;

import java.util.Collection;
import java.util.List;
import java.util.Map;

/**
 * Defines methods that must be implemented by statistics processors
 * working with {@code StreamingSampleStats}.
 *
 * @see Statistic
 * @see StreamingSampleStats
 *
 * @author Michael Bedward
 * @author Daniele Romagnoli, GeoSolutions S.A.S.
 * @since 1.0
 * @source $URL: https://jai-tools.googlecode.com/svn/tags/1.0.1/utils/src/main/java/jaitools/numeric/Processor.java $
 * @version $Id: Processor.java 1175 2010-04-16 10:59:57Z michael.bedward $
 */
public interface Processor {

    /**
     * Get the {@code Statistics} supported by this processor.
     *
     * @return supported {@code Statistics}
     */
    public Collection getSupported();

    /**
     * Set a {@code Range} of values to exclude from calculations, ie. if a sample
     * value in this range is offered it will be ignored.
     *
     * @param exclude a range of values to exclude
     * @deprecated Please use {@link #addRange(Range, jaitools.numeric.Range.Type))}
     */
    public void addExcludedRange(Range exclude);
    
    /**
     * Set a {@code Range} of values to be considered as NoData. Processors
     * count the number of NoData values offered as samples but exclude them from
     * calculations.
     * 

* NoData ranges take precedence over included / excluded data ranges. * * @param noData a range of values to be excluded */ public void addNoDataRange(Range noData); /** * Convenience method for specifying a single value to be considered as NoData. * * @param noData the value to be treated as NoData * * @see #addNoDataRange(jaitools.numeric.Range) */ public void addNoDataValue(Double noData); /** * Set a {@code Range} of values to exclude from/include in calculations * * @param range a range of values to be checked * @param rangeType the type of range. Note that you can only add range of the same type. * Otherwise, you will get an {@link IllegalArgumentException}. */ public void addRange(Range range, final Range.Type rangeType); /** * Set a {@code Range} of values to exclude/include from calculations, ie. if a sample * value in this range is offered it will be ignored/accepted. The behavior depends * on how the rangesType have been set. * * @param a range of values to be checked */ public void addRange(Range range); /** * Set the {@code Range.Type} of the ranges to be added to the processor. * It is worth to point out that this method can be called only one time in case the rangesType * haven't been specified at construction time and no ranges have been added yet. * * @param rangeType the type of range. */ public void setRangesType(Range.Type rangeType); /** * Get the type of {@code Ranges} being used by this processor. * * @return the rangesType of this processor */ public Range.Type getRangesType (); /** * Retrieve the {@code Ranges} of sample values excluded from calculations. * * @return the excluded {@code Ranges} or an empty list if no exclusions * are defined * @deprecated Please use {@link #getRanges()} */ public List> getExcludedRanges(); /** * Retrieve the {@code Ranges} of sample values to be considered as NoData. * * @return the NoData {@code Ranges} or an empty list if no NoData are defined */ public List> getNoDataRanges(); /** * Retrieve the {@code Ranges} of sample values excluded from/included in calculations. * * @return the {@code Ranges} or an empty list if no ranges are defined */ public List> getRanges(); /** * Test whether a sample value will be excluded from calculations by * the processor. * * @param sample the sample value * * @return true if the sample lies within an excluded {@code Range} set * for this processor; false otherwise * @deprecated Please use {@link #isAccepted} */ public boolean isExcluded(Double sample); /** * Test whether a sample value will be accepted for calculations by * the processor. * * @param sample the sample value * * @return true if the sample is accepted in compliance with the ranges settings. * false otherwise */ public boolean isAccepted(Double sample); /** * Offer a sample value to the processor. * * @param sample the sample value */ public void offer(Double sample); /** * Get the number of samples that have been offered to this processor. * * @return number of samples offered */ public long getNumOffered(); /** * Get the number of samples that have been accepted by this processor * (ie. contributed to the calculations). * * @return number of samples used for calculations */ public long getNumAccepted(); /** * Get the number of NaN samples passed to the processor * * @return number of NaN samples */ public long getNumNaN(); /** * Get the number of NoData samples passed to the processor. This count * includes values in user-specified NoData ranges and Double.NaN values. * * @return number of NoData samples * * @see #addNoDataRange(jaitools.numeric.Range) * @see #addNoDataValue(java.lang.Double) */ public long getNumNoData(); /** * Get the value of the statistic calculated by this processor. * * @param stat the specified statistic * * @return the value of the statistic if it has been calculated or * Double.NaN otherwise * * @throws IllegalArgumentException if {@code stat} is not supported * by this processor */ public Double get(Statistic stat) throws IllegalArgumentException; /** * Get the value of all statistics calculated by this processor. * * @return the calculated statistic(s) */ public Map get(); }
